Florence Nightingale: Social Reformer And Pioneer Of Nursing
Description
Florence Nightingale: Social Reformer And Pioneer Of NursingPerfect for children aged 8+, this accessible biography of Florence Nightingale's life shows us why we still remember her today 200 years after her birth (May 1820).
